**Handover: mothwing-dedup**

Taking over? Quick notes. Dedup service is stable but the suppression window was bumped Tuesday after the pager storm — don't roll it back. Grouping keys now include cluster name. One flaky node keeps restarting; ignore unless it pages twice in an hour. Current running configuration is below.

config for yajep-tafof:
[rusath]
team = julmir
access_code = ac_fe37fd
host = rusath.novactech.test
port = 8000
owner = pelmir.weneth
peer = oliwyn.olvarqdyn.internal

## Break-Glass: Orders Soft-Delete Restore

On-call friends: when a customer order vanishes from the Tinwhistle storefront, it's almost always a soft delete — the row is still in the orders table with a deleted flag set. Normal restores go through the Undelete job, but if that queue is jammed, you can break glass and flip the flag directly in the replica console. Authenticate to the break-glass prompt with the passphrase shown immediately below.

strongbox words: oliath-framir

Briefing — Reseller Programme Review. Branch managers: the Tarnwell reseller programme moves to tiered margins next quarter. Silver tier requires two certified staff; gold requires four plus demo stock. Onboarding of new partners pauses until accreditation backlog clears. Fenley branch pilots the new portal first. Non-performing resellers will be exited at renewal. Raise exceptions with your regional lead. Strategic rationale and targets appear directly below.

internal memo for kawip-hadug: Headcount on the Wenwyn team goes from 7 to 140 by the end of January. Gross margin on Wenwyn came in at 20 percent against a plan of 15 percent.